Download Sample Ask For Discount Japan Reversing Light Market By Type Segment Analysis The Japan reversing light market is primarily classified into incandescent, LED, and halogen-based segments, with LED technology increasingly gaining prominence due to its superior energy efficiency, longevity, and brightness. Incandescent reversing lights, traditionally dominant, are gradually declining in market share as automakers and consumers shift toward more sustainable and technologically advanced options. LED reversing lights, characterized by their low power consumption and rapid response times, are rapidly capturing market attention, especially in new vehicle models. Halogen lights, once a standard, are now considered a transitional technology, with limited growth prospects as the industry gravitates toward LED solutions. The market size for LED reversing lights is estimated to have surpassed USD 250 million in 2023,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 8% over the past five years, driven by regulatory pressures and consumer demand for energy-efficient lighting solutions. The fastest-growing segment within the market is clearly the LED reversing light category, which is expected to maintain a CAGR of around 9% over the next decade. This growth is fueled by stricter vehicle lighting regulations, increasing adoption of adv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), and automakers’ strategic shift toward electrification and smart vehicle features. The LED segment is currently in the growth stage, characterized by rapid technological innovation, expanding application across various vehicle types, and increasing aftermarket penetration. Conversely, incandescent reversing lights are approaching market saturation, with declining demand as manufacturers phase out older vehicle models and retrofit markets favor LED upgrades. Japan Reversing Light Market By Application Segment Analysis The application landscape of the Japan reversing light market is primarily segmented into passenger vehicles, commercial vehicles, and specialty vehicles. Passenger vehicles constitute the largest share, accounting for approximately 70% of the total market in 2023, driven by the high vehicle population and stringent safety regulations. Reversing lights in passenger cars are increasingly integrated with advanced safety features, such as backup cameras and proximity sensors, which enhance visibility and pedestrian safety. Commercial vehicles, including trucks and buses, represent a significant segment as well, with a focus on durability and high-intensity lighting to ensure safety during cargo handling and nighttime operations. Specialty vehicles, such as construction and agricultural machinery, also utilize reversing lights, though their market share remains comparatively smaller. The overall market size for reversing lights in Japan was estimated at around USD 400 million in 2023, with a CAGR of approximately 6% projected over the next five years, driven by fleet modernization and safety compliance mandates.
